We use a PCA9450BHNY to supply an i.MX8 Nano.
During production testing, we measure the Voltage of Buck 1 (V_0V95_SOC) and Buck2 (V_0V85_ARM) an check the voltage Limits of 0.85V +/- 2%.
During this test, the CPU stops and the flash is unprogrammed.
Beginning in August 2026 the Voltage rises and violates the upper limit at some boards.
Not only the individual Voltages of a board rises, also the mean value of thousands of boards.
There was an PCN (202502007F01 : PCA9450 / MP90 Dual Wafer Fabrication Source Expansion
from SSMC to PSMC) last year (25.04.2025)
Can the new wafer fab a possible source of the problem?

An internal investigation revealed that the problem was caused by worn test probes contacting the test points on the printed circuit board. We replaced the test probes, and the voltages are now within the permissible range.
